Have you ever considered what will happen to your years of genealogy research once you're gone? Learn how to ensure that your hard work carries on. Through a combination of planning, common sense, and new technologies, you'll learn how to create an action plan for preserving your genealogy research. Thomas MacEntee a genealogist specializing in the use of technology and social media to improve genealogical research and a founder of GeneaBloggers will be the presenter.
